Workstation

License: Unlicense

Workstation is a dockerized ubuntu environment, meant for ease of development. Good place for tutorials and learning new skills.

Container Bootup

Getting Started

Assuming you have both docker and docker-compose up and running on your local machine, you should be good to go with spinning up a new Workstation instance. Just run:

bash run.sh

to fire off a new build and tunnel into an new bash session.

To install all dependencies enumerated in the README, as well as updating the .bashrc, run:

bash init.sh

This should take a few minutes, and may require some interactivity (specifically for setting up python). Currently the best way to pick/choose language dependencies is to manually comment in/out that init.sh file, working on that in the future.

Contribution Notes

This is more so a personal playground rather than an open software project. I would recommend forking this repository for personal use and wiping out everything under the workspace/ heirarchy.

Git commit messages are non-standard and otherwise difficult to follow, as much of the work done here is only meant for version controlling personal progress as opposed to providing readability.
